Easter Garland

$3.90

Note: This is for the PDF PATTERN to make the amigurumi, NOT the finished product.

Included
- 1 PDF pattern, total 12 pages
- Beginner instructions
- Step by step photo tutorials
- Final pieces measuring about 8cm tall (3 inches) using sport yarn (weight 2) and crochet hook size 3.0 mm. They can be made bigger with bulkier yarn and bigger hook.

Crochet skill level
- Beginner
- Some basic crochet skills are needed, such as the following: single crochet, increases, working into FLO/BLO, sewing attachments

Crochet equipment
- Sport size yarn (weight 2)
- Crochet hook size 3mm
- Others - darning needles, stitch markers, glass eyes
